My problem involved writing an Audio Controller in Svelte in an elegant fashion. I wanted to eliminate my ‘if(okToPlaySound === true)` statements sprinkled throughout my spaghetti code.
If you watch Code with Stanislav’s (YouTube video)[https://www.youtube.com/watch?v=nXIMQr12nqw], you will learn that Opus 4.5 scored 100% with a test harness of 100 problems using a variety of different Svelte 5 runes and other challenging tasks. The score is from Stanislav’s (Svelte Benchmark)[https://github.com/khromov/svelte-bench]. The bottom line is Opus 4.5 and greater are extremely capable of generating solid Svelte 5 code.

static/audio/The audio controller code helped move my Space Invaders project forward and presented me with more elegant code than I was generating. For example, my mute button calls one function and either turns the volume off or on globally. For a given audio file, I just play it based upon the game state, no more if (okToPlaySound === true) statements as the volume is either on or off globally. I just play the audio file and if the volume (or gain in Howler.js) is on then you hear the sound, if not then silence. So simple in hindsight.
